Summary of Heat Pump Efficiency
HVAC system efficiency is a critical consideration for homeowners looking to enhance energy savings while preserving comfortable indoor temperatures. A HVAC system works by moving heat from one area to a different location, which makes it a extremely efficient option compared to conventional heating systems. The performance of a HVAC system is often measured by its coefficient of performance, which indicates how much heating or cooling is created for each of energy consumed. A higher COP means better efficiency, allowing homeowners to enjoy lower expenses.
The performance of a HVAC system can be influenced by various factors, including the temperature outside, the type and size of the system, and its installation standard. In colder climates, HVAC systems are designed to draw heat even in very cold temperatures, but their performance may diminish as the outdoor temperature drops. Therefore, choosing the appropriate HVAC model for the local climate in the Denver area is important for optimal performance. Moreover, professional installation by trained technicians guarantees that the system operates at its most efficient level.

Common Heat Pump Repairs
Heat exchangers, while effective, can face a range of problems that necessitate repair and attention. One frequent problem is a coolant leak. This happens when the refrigerant, which is crucial for temperature regulation, leaves the system. Symptoms of a coolant leak include impaired heating or cooling efficiency and ice formation on the coils. Fixing refrigerant leaks needs a certified technician who can locate the leak, repair it, and top off the system with the appropriate coolant.
Another typical concern is a defective thermostat. If the thermostat is not calibrated correctly or is malfunctioning, it can lead to incorrect temperature regulation. This may show up as the heat pump running continuously or not operating at all. Regular check-ups can assist identify thermostat faults early, but if concerns arise, a technician can recalibrate or swap out the thermostat to guarantee optimal operation.
Blocked filters are also a common repair issue. When the filters become dirty and blocked, airflow is restricted, resulting in reduced efficiency and likely overheating of the system. Regular change of filters is crucial to avoid this problem, but if a clog does occur, it may need a specialist to maintain or swap out parts to return proper operation to the HVAC system.
Scheduled Heating System Service Services
Consistent maintenance is essential for ensuring your heat pump works effectively and dependably. Regular maintenance services typically encompass cleaning the air filters, inspecting the ductwork, and evaluating the refrigerant levels. A clear air filter allows for maximum airflow, which is essential for the heat pump's performance. Ignoring the filters can lead to increased energy use and possible breakdowns. Ensuring that the ductwork is free of blockages and leaks will also boost the system's performance and lifespan.
One more crucial aspect of heat pump maintenance is the periodic check-up conducted by professionals. During this service, technicians will assess the electrical connections, measure voltage and current on motors, and analyze the overall mechanical condition of the unit. This forward-thinking approach helps detect any issues early on, allowing for quick repairs that prevent costly replacements down the line. By committing to routine maintenance, homeowners can substantially enhance the longevity and efficiency of their heat pump systems.

Heat Pumper Change Considerations
When contemplating heat pump replacement, one ought to important to analyze the duration and effectiveness of your current system. Most heat pumps have a duration of approximately ten to fifteen years, thus if yours is getting to this time, it may be the right moment to reflect on an enhancement. A higher efficient design can bring about significant savings on energy expenses and increase your home's satisfaction. Assessing the repair record is also vital; regular issues may indicate that it is more economically sensible to change your unit than to persisting with maintenance.
An additional critical factor is the dimension of your heat pump. An incorrectly sized unit can cause ineffective functioning, increased energy expenses, and decreased comfort. An experienced service technician can conduct a load assessment to identify the right size for your home, ensuring optimal performance. Investing time in deciding on the proper size can stop problems down the road and extend the durability of your upgraded setup.

Installation Optimal Guidelines for Heat Units
Proper setup of heat pumps is crucial for improving performance and ensuring durability. To start, it is important to dimension the unit accurately, taking into account the specific heating and cooling needs of the space. An insufficiently sized or excessively sized unit can lead to repeated cycling, increased power consumption, and decreased comfort levels. Additionally, it's essential to select an setup location with adequate room around the system for adequate airflow, which contributes in enhancing efficiency.
One more best guideline involves making sure that the unit is level and secured firmly. This avoids vibrations and noise problems, boosting the total satisfaction. The installation location should also be protected from harsh elements, as this can affect the unit's efficiency and lifespan. Furthermore, the application of top-notch components and parts during setup is vital to eliminate future repairs and to ensure consistent performance over the long term.
Finally, correct ductwork setup is essential for achieving efficient ventilation and proper climate control throughout the area. Repairing any leaks in the duct system can greatly improve the heat pump's performance, reducing utility bills.
